Product Description
The TOGGLER ALLIGATOR A10 flush-mount anchor provides a secure hold in solid concrete, brick, and stone, includes #14 x 2-1/4'' sheet metal screws for fastening, and is made in USA. Once inserted flush with the surface of a 3/8'' drilled hole in a wall, ceiling, or floor, the anchor accepts an included screw. The fins on the anchor head grip the mounting material to prevent spinning when a screw is inserted. The polypropylene body resists corrosion and expands to fill and mold to a hole when a screw is inserted. This helps distribute the force evenly throughout the anchor''s length to help prevent fracture of the mounting material. Anchors provide reinforcement to fasteners installed in materials that are considered brittle or have insufficient hold such as drywall, concrete, brick, and stone. Anchors provide support through methods such as expansion from within or behind the substrate, or insertion of adhesive compounds into drilled holes.
